Te Whiwhinga mahi | The opportunity

We are seeking an organised and proactive Operations Coordinator to support the delivery of programmes, workshops and events within Te Pūtahi Mātauranga | Faculty of Arts and Education. Working closely with project leads and a wider professional services network, you will play a key role in ensuring operational and administrative processes run smoothly and efficiently.

In this role, you will:

  • Coordinate programme and workshop logistics, including registrations, materials, CRM data and participant communications
  • Support the delivery of online and in-person events, including scheduling, set-up, and stakeholder coordination
  • Provide financial and supplier administration support, including purchasing, reconciliation and compliance with University processes
  • Assist with course and content administration, reporting and evaluations
  • Provide general project and operational support, including meeting coordination and travel bookings

This is a part-time (0.6FTE / 22.5 hours per week), fixed term position until the end of December 2026.
Occasional weekend work may be required, depending on programme and event needs.

The salary range for this role is $56,400 - $71,000 per annum (pro rata for part-time hours) depending on skills and experience relevant to the role. 

As this role involves delivering workshops and providing on-site support, travel to locations within Auckland and occasionally outside the region is required, therefore you must have an NZ Drivers License.

He kōrero mōu | About you

To succeed in this role, you will bring:

  • Proven experience in an operations, administration, project or event coordination role
  • Strong organisational skills, attention to detail, and the ability to manage competing priorities
  • Confidence working with CRM systems, digital platforms and Microsoft Office
  • Excellent interpersonal and communication skills, with the ability to build effective working relationships
  • A proactive, flexible approach and willingness to support team members as needed

Advantageous:

  • Bilingual capability in Chinese and English, particularly to support translation of reports
